What Exactly is a “Keep What You Win” Bonus in 2026?
It’s simple. You deposit, you get a bonus (usually free spins or a match), and whatever you win from that bonus is yours. No wagering requirements. No 35x playthrough on top of your deposit. You hit a spin on a pokie, win $500, you cash out $500. That is the dream, right?
From what I’ve seen, these are becoming more common for Aussie players in 2026 because the market is getting smarter. Players got sick of grinding through impossible terms. But here is the catch: these bonuses are usually smaller in size. You won’t see a $1,000 match with no wagering. You’ll see a $50 no wager bonus or 50 free spins on a specific pokie like Mega Moolah or 9 Masks of Fire.
For a high roller, that sounds weak. But if you use it as a testing ground for a new casino’s payout speed or VIP treatment, it is a smart move. It lets you see how they handle real withdrawals without locking your money up.
Three Things You Should NEVER Do at a No Wager Casino
I’ve made these mistakes. I’ve lost money because I was careless. Here is what I tell my friends who ask about the best no wager bonus australia 2026 keep what you win promotions.
1. Never Ignore the Max Win Cap
This is the biggest trap. A bonus might have zero wagering, but it will have a max cashout. I saw one offer from a big brand (I won’t name them, but it rhymes with “Betway”) that gave 50 free spins on a pokie with a $100 max win. You hit a $5,000 jackpot? You only get $100. The rest vanishes.
Always check the “Max Cashout” or “Max Win” line in the terms. For high rollers, this is a dealbreaker. If the cap is lower than $500, I walk away. It is not worth the time.
2. Never Play High Volatility Pokies on a Small Bonus
This sounds counter-intuitive. You want to hit a big win, right? But if you have a $20 no wager bonus, playing a pokie like Dead or Alive 2 (which pays once every 100 spins) is suicide. You will burn through the bonus before you see a single win.
Stick to low or medium volatility pokies. Something like Starburst or Book of Dead (on a low bet level). You want to preserve your balance and grind out a few small wins. That is how you actually walk away with cash.

3. Never Assume the Bonus Applies to All Games
I made this mistake last year. I took a “keep what you win” deposit match. I immediately went to play Blackjack. I won $200. I tried to withdraw. Rejected. The bonus was only valid for pokies. The terms said “eligible games only” in fine print.
If you are a table game player like me, you need to read the game restrictions. Most of these no wager deals are strictly for pokies. Some exclude progressive jackpots too. So if you want to play Mega Moolah, check if the bonus even counts toward that network.

FAQ: No Wager Bonuses for Aussie Players
Can I withdraw the bonus amount itself?
No. You only keep the winnings. The bonus amount (e.g., the $50 match) is usually removed when you withdraw. So if you win $100 from a $50 bonus, you keep the $100, not the $150.
Are these bonuses available on mobile?
Yes, almost all of them. I play on my phone all the time. Just check the terms. Some offers are “desktop only” but that is rare in 2026.
Do no wager bonuses affect my VIP status?
From what I’ve seen, yes. If you only take no wager bonuses and never deposit big, the VIP team will ignore you. You need to mix in real deposits to get the high withdrawal limits and personal host. The no wager bonus is a tool, not a lifestyle.
What about progressive jackpots like Mega Moolah?
Most no wager bonuses exclude progressives. You cannot use free spins on Mega Moolah and keep the jackpot. That would bankrupt the casino. If you want to hit a network jackpot, you need to use your own cash.
